Output e96a4b7d76be6efa0d4d53b6969be3325e75ed44c61756dfdadcdf896321a692:1

value
636595
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e31f4b480802af8dea78a4adffd586363165179c OP_EQUALVERIFY OP_CHECKSIG
address
1MhustwKpNhvHhwP1sdKwBvtrPyizFVeyU
transaction
e96a4b7d76be6efa0d4d53b6969be3325e75ed44c61756dfdadcdf896321a692
confirmations
240943
spent
true